Answer:

h(-6) = -28

Explanation:

Given Question:

  • To find the value of h(-6)

Given Polynomial:

  • h(x) = 5x + 2

Solution:

As given Polynomial,

h(x) = 5x + 2

So the value of Polynomial when x = -6,

h(-6) = 5(-6) + 2

= -30 + 2

= -28

Hence,

Hence, Value of h(-6) is - 28 (Ans)
